Chandler Celebrates Hispanic Heritage
 
CHANDLER, Ariz. – Residents are invited to a free celebration of Hispanic Heritage with a night of music, dance and performance from 5 to 9 p.m. Saturday, Sept. 19 in Downtown Chandler’s AJ Chandler Park – west of Arizona Ave.
 
Entertainment will include a free evening performance of Por Amor by James Garcia, a romantic comedy about love, fame, greed and behind-the-scenes treachery in the world of touring theater. In addition, visitors will enjoy Mariachi Music, Opendance and Flamenco del Sol Dancers.
 
The Hispanic Heritage Celebration is produced by Xico, which is located in downtown Chandler and is one of the oldest ethnic nonprofit heritage organizations in the state, whose vision is to promote indigenous arts and culture through community based arts programs.
 
Hispanic Heritage Celebration is presented by The Chandler Republic, and supported by the City of Chandler and the Downtown Chandler Community Partnership.
